Index
Service com.soffid.iam.sync.service.ServerService
[UseCase]
Spring bean name
ServerServiceBase
Description
EJB bean name
- Sync server only -
Service methods
hasSupportAccessHost
hostId
long
userId
long
Returns
boolean
updateExpiredPasswords
usuari
es.caib.seycon.ng.comu.Usuari
externalAuth
boolean
Returns
boolean
getAddonJar
addon
java.lang.String
Returns
byte[]
getPluginJar
classname
java.lang.String
Returns
byte[]
getUserMazingerRules
userId
long
version
java.lang.String
Returns
byte[]
getCustomObject
type
java.lang.String
name
java.lang.String
Returns
com.soffid.iam.api.CustomObject
getAccountInfo
Retrieves an account from soffid database
accountName
java.lang.String
dispatcherId
java.lang.String
Returns
es.caib.seycon.ng.comu.Account
getUserData
userId
long
data
java.lang.String
Returns
es.caib.seycon.ng.comu.DadaUsuari
getDispatcherInfo
codi
java.lang.String
Returns
es.caib.seycon.ng.comu.Dispatcher
getDispatcherAccessControl
dispatcherId
java.lang.Long
Returns
es.caib.seycon.ng.comu.DispatcherAccessControl
getGroupInfo
codi
java.lang.String
dispatcherId
java.lang.String
Returns
es.caib.seycon.ng.comu.Grup
getMailList
list
java.lang.String
domain
java.lang.String
Returns
es.caib.seycon.ng.comu.LlistaCorreu
getHostInfo
hostName
java.lang.String
Returns
es.caib.seycon.ng.comu.Maquina
getHostInfoByIP
ip
java.lang.String
Returns
es.caib.seycon.ng.comu.Maquina
generateFakePassword
passwordDomain
java.lang.String
Returns
es.caib.seycon.ng.comu.Password
generateFakePassword
account
java.lang.String
dispatcherId
java.lang.String
Returns
es.caib.seycon.ng.comu.Password
getAccountPassword
account
java.lang.String
dispatcher
java.lang.String
Returns
es.caib.seycon.ng.comu.Password
getOrGenerateUserPassword
account
java.lang.String
dispatcherId
java.lang.String
Returns
es.caib.seycon.ng.comu.Password
validatePassword
account
java.lang.String
dispatcherId
java.lang.String
p
es.caib.seycon.ng.comu.Password
Returns
es.caib.seycon.ng.comu.PasswordValidation
getUserPolicy
account
java.lang.String
dispatcherId
java.lang.String
Returns
es.caib.seycon.ng.comu.PoliticaContrasenya
getRoleInfo
role
java.lang.String
bd
java.lang.String
Returns
es.caib.seycon.ng.comu.Rol
getUserInfo
account
java.lang.String
dispatcherId
java.lang.String
Returns
es.caib.seycon.ng.comu.Usuari
getUserInfo
certs
java.security.cert.X509Certificate[]
Returns
es.caib.seycon.ng.comu.Usuari
getUserInfo
userId
long
Returns
es.caib.seycon.ng.comu.Usuari
getNetworkInfo
network
java.lang.String
Returns
es.caib.seycon.ng.comu.Xarxa
getPlugin
className
java.lang.String
Returns
es.caib.seycon.ng.sync.agent.Plugin
getConfig
param
java.lang.String
Returns
java.lang.String
getDefaultDispatcher
Returns
java.lang.String
reverseTranslate
domain
java.lang.String
column2
java.lang.String
Returns
java.lang.String
translate
domain
java.lang.String
column1
java.lang.String
Returns
java.lang.String
getAccountExplicitRoles
account
java.lang.String
dispatcherId
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.RolGrant
>
getAccountRoles
account
java.lang.String
dispatcherId
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.RolGrant
>
getExpiredPasswordDomains
usuari
es.caib.seycon.ng.comu.Usuari
Returns
java.util.Collection<
es.caib.seycon.ng.comu.DominiContrasenya
>
getGroupChildren
groupId
long
dispatcherId
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.Grup
>
getGroupExplicitRoles
groupId
long
Returns
java.util.Collection<
es.caib.seycon.ng.comu.RolGrant
>
getGroupUsers
groupId
long
nomesUsuarisActius
boolean
dispatcherId
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.Usuari
>
getHostsFromNetwork
networkId
long
Returns
java.util.Collection<
es.caib.seycon.ng.comu.Maquina
>
getMailListMembers
mail
java.lang.String
domainName
java.lang.String
Returns
java.util.Collection< java.lang.Object >
getNetworksList
Returns
java.util.Collection<
es.caib.seycon.ng.comu.Xarxa
>
getRoleAccounts
roleId
long
dispatcherId
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.Account
>
getRoleActiveAccounts
roleId
long
dispatcher
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.Account
>
getRoleExplicitRoles
roleId
long
Returns
java.util.Collection<
es.caib.seycon.ng.comu.RolGrant
>
getUserAccounts
userId
long
dispatcherId
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.UserAccount
>
getUserData
userId
long
Returns
java.util.Collection<
es.caib.seycon.ng.comu.DadaUsuari
>
getUserExplicitRoles
userId
long
dispatcherId
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.RolGrant
>
getUserGroups
userId
java.lang.Long
Returns
java.util.Collection<
es.caib.seycon.ng.comu.Grup
>
getUserGroups
accountName
java.lang.String
dispatcherId
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.Grup
>
getUserGroupsHierarchy
userId
java.lang.Long
Returns
java.util.Collection<
es.caib.seycon.ng.comu.Grup
>
getUserGroupsHierarchy
accountName
java.lang.String
dispatcherId
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.Grup
>
getUserPrinters
userId
java.lang.Long
Returns
java.util.Collection<
es.caib.seycon.ng.comu.UsuariImpressora
>
getUserRoles
userId
long
dispatcherid
java.lang.String
Returns
java.util.Collection<
es.caib.seycon.ng.comu.RolGrant
>
getUserSecrets
userId
long
Returns
java.util.Collection<
es.caib.seycon.ng.comu.sso.Secret
>
reverseTranslate2
domain
java.lang.String
column2
java.lang.String
Returns
java.util.Collection<
com.soffid.iam.api.AttributeTranslation
>
translate2
domain
java.lang.String
column1
java.lang.String
Returns
java.util.Collection<
com.soffid.iam.api.AttributeTranslation
>
getAddonList
Returns
java.util.List< java.lang.String >
getUserAttributes